How to Promote My Candle Business: Strategies for Success
In today’s competitive market, promoting your candle business effectively is crucial for attracting customers and building a strong brand presence. With the right strategies, you can increase your sales, expand your customer base, and establish a reputation for quality and innovation. Here are some effective ways to promote your candle business:
1. Leverage Social Media Platforms
Social media is a powerful tool for promoting your candle business. Create engaging content that showcases your products, shares customer testimonials, and highlights your brand’s unique selling points. Regularly post high-quality images and videos of your candles in various settings, such as homes, offices, and outdoor events. Utilize hashtags to increase your reach and engage with your audience by responding to comments and messages.
2. Build an E-commerce Website
An e-commerce website is essential for selling your candles online. Ensure your website is user-friendly, mobile-responsive, and showcases your products effectively. Include detailed product descriptions, high-resolution images, and customer reviews. Implement a secure payment gateway and offer multiple shipping options to enhance the customer experience.
3. Collaborate with Influencers
Influencer marketing can help you reach a wider audience. Partner with influencers who have a strong following in your target market and align with your brand values. They can create content featuring your candles, share their personal experiences, and encourage their followers to purchase your products.
4. Host Pop-Up Events and Workshops
Hosting pop-up events and workshops can attract new customers and create buzz around your brand. Offer samples of your candles, provide educational content about candle-making, and offer discounts or special offers to attendees. This approach can help you build a loyal customer base and generate word-of-mouth referrals.
5. Utilize Email Marketing
Email marketing is an effective way to keep your customers engaged and informed about your latest products and promotions. Create a compelling newsletter that includes product updates, behind-the-scenes content, and exclusive offers. Segment your email list to send personalized messages to different customer groups.
6. Offer Loyalty Programs and Referral Incentives
Loyalty programs and referral incentives can encourage repeat purchases and word-of-mouth referrals. Offer discounts, free products, or exclusive access to new collections for customers who make multiple purchases or refer friends. This approach can help you build a strong community of loyal customers.
7. Participate in Trade Shows and Expos
Attending trade shows and expos can help you showcase your products to a wider audience and connect with potential distributors and retailers. Prepare an eye-catching booth, offer samples, and provide information about your brand and products. This approach can help you expand your reach and establish your brand as a leader in the candle industry.
8. Invest in Quality Packaging and Branding
Investing in high-quality packaging and branding can make your candles stand out on store shelves and in online marketplaces. Use attractive, eco-friendly materials and create a cohesive brand identity that reflects your brand values and product quality.
